The Cheaper way to Stretch your Piercings

Step 2Now what?

Now what?
There is one hurdle, which is that, they sell this stuff by fractional inch dimensions 1/8", 1/4" ect... Piercings go by gauges. You just need to find what your gauge is when converted to inches. Then get the appropriate stock. There are several gauge to inch chart-tables out there on the Internet.
Length-wise they sell it by the foot, which ought to be way more than you'll ever need.
Next, we have a couple materials to choose from. Most of the plastics are bio-compatible, but if you're not sure, or if you have allergic reactions, for god sake, be careful & LOOK IT UP! Otherwise you will end up with a swollen, infected mess.
I bought the Poly-Carbonate, Acrylic and the PTFE
